<p><a href="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/05/little_big_planet_1280x1024.jpg"></a>I am a total pain in the ass in online games.</p>
<p>Awkward, Frozen, and I have started playing Little Big Planet online and I&#8217;ve gotta say, it&#8217;s really fucking fun. We&#8217;ve only been playing fan-made levels so far but we&#8217;re going to go through the campaign (for the second time, but first time online together) soon.</p>
<p>What&#8217;s really cool is that while you&#8217;re in a fan-made level, other random players can join you until there are four people in the room, and A, F, and I all have mics, and the random players who join mostly likely don&#8217;t, and what ensues is just total and complete pain-in-the-ass-ery. Most of the other random players join in by typing through their gamepad or keyoard, so no real hard feelings. But god, this game is just awesome . Why are there not more multiplayer games out like this?</p>
<p>I think what makes it pretty unique is the ability to make the sackboys (the characters you control) move their arms, heads, bodies, and facial expressions at will, (and even their mouths when you talk through the mic). The level of expression possible while playing is just amazing and it really does a good job at involving you in the gameplay. There&#8217;s a lot more immersion into the game when you not only get to decide what your little guy looks like, but how he expresses himself and behaves with more detail. It&#8217;s a good example of what customization should be reaching for with online multiplayer games. While it&#8217;s fun to design characters in MMOs like Guild Wars, WoW, and FPSs, what people really have a fun time doing are silly things that allow them to really have control and personality while &#8220;in character.&#8221; Dancing, singing, taking pictures, etc.</p>
<p>I think game developers really underestimate that many players want Role Playing in these kinds of games, and not just the role of being a soldier or warrior or mage or whatever, but actually playing the role of the <em>character</em>,<em> </em>and that means being able to make the character do what you feel like doing in the world. Even in games that don&#8217;t allow customization or multiple players, such as the Final Fantasy series, the same desire applies. Players want to play AS that character. It&#8217;s not just a matter of moving them through one part of the game to the next, even with an engaging story.</p>
<p>This is why so many old fans of the Final Fantasy games are getting disappointed with the new releases. Look at games like Final Fantasy 7 and many of the fans will say some of the best parts are the side quests and mini-games. Chocobo racing to get out of prison anyone? Most of the mini-games and side quests pertain to the storyline (though some great ones don&#8217;t have anything to do with the plot at all), but they&#8217;re a nice break from the same proceed-to-the-next-stage kind of gameplay, plus it allows the player to see some of the game character&#8217;s personality. Nowadays, the biggest complaint most gamers have about new Final Fantasy games is the linear gameplay &#8211; the lack of side quests and mini games. They don&#8217;t want to just basically watch the game with their only involvement being battles or walking from here to there or in some games just hitting square at the right moment in a quick time event. They want to live in that world. They want free-roam and free-expression.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s what makes gamers gamers and not movie fanatics (not that a person can&#8217;t be both). Gamers don&#8217;t want JUST an amazing story and good characters and music. They want <strong><em>interaction</em></strong>.</p>
<p>If gamers aren&#8217;t enjoying the interaction, which can be made up from a  combination of elements, then they&#8217;ll start to  wonder why they&#8217;re investing 30+ hours into a game when they could  just watch a really good movie.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s kind of a fuzzy concept because interaction could mean anything. You interact with the story by moving the character through it and possibly altering the ending. Character interaction could come from simple dialogue or even deciding who the main character ends up with romantically. Gameplay is where you get the most interaction, through boss fights, exploration, character movement, and collecting items, etc. And music is where the least interaction is usually needed/expected, although there are many games that play with sounds and the affect you can have on them as a player.</p>
<p>And, yes, any one of these categories done well alone could make a stellar game even when it&#8217;s lacking in other categories. But what game developers need to be doing with new games is use all their resources to allow the player to be in that game world. Different genres would go about this differently, of course, but the goal should be the same. Immersion.</p>
<p>Interaction.</p>
<p>Little Big Planet does it right. Even though the campaign story is kind of lame and some of the fan made levels are cooler than the real ones, the ability to even try to make cooler levels is a huge part of the game. This is a game about expression, and the developers integrated that into as many elements as possible. The campaign serves more as a learning tool, source of inspiration, and a place to collect objects and costumes to use when designing your own level, your home pod, or your character.</p>
<p>Game developers need to focus on what their game is about and then just put absolutely everything possible into making it the best experience  they can provide with that focus in mind.</p>
<p>Little Big Planet isn&#8217;t as epic in story as Final Fantasy #Whatever, but it is a damn good game with excellent player interaction. The (mostly old) Final Fantasy games achieve that same status for different reasons. Many  games have done things right, and have given great experiences and   interactions. But many more have been complete flops, and in an  industry  that is still young and growing and, at this particular moment in time, primarily focused on  exposure and  profit, I can&#8217;t help but  notice the  lack of effort to really give the player a chance to fully  experience  their games and interact with them in ways they want to. With this new generation of consoles, there has been a huge drop in damn good games being produced, and it&#8217;s just disappointing.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p style="text-align: left;">I have an addiction. Now, that&#8217;s nothing new. I&#8217;ve always had one, to comics and animation and whatnot, but this. This is something I can&#8217;t even explain. I mean a full-strength, life-debilitating addiction. For work by Rumiko Takahashi, and most recently, particularly her romance series Maison Ikkoku.</p>
<p style="text-align: left;">
<p style="text-align: center;"><a href="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/MI-01-01-01.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-766" title="MI-01-01-01" src="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/MI-01-01-01.jpg" alt="" width="361" height="563" /></a></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">I got access to this manga series about&#8230;a week ago? Two weeks maximum. I hadn&#8217;t even planned on reading it in the first place, but a lot of users on <a href="http://www.myanimelist.net">myanimelist.net</a> have it rated highly, and many in the manga/anime community in general claim it&#8217;s the best romance series out there. Now, I don&#8217;t know about that &#8211; I haven&#8217;t read enough romance manga to make that claim, but that statement got me to look into it and holy smokes, if it&#8217;s not the best, it&#8217;s damn high on the list.</p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Briefly, the series is about a group of people living at a boarding house. You have Mrs. Ichinose and her son and husband; Yotsuya; Akemi; and Godai. They&#8217;re an eccentric crew, and the story opens in chaos &#8211; which is also where the story ends up staying most of the time &#8211; and chaos is the first thing that greets Kyoko, the brand new manager of the property. She&#8217;s beautiful, she&#8217;s young, and she&#8217;s a widow &#8211; and to Godai, the young student trying to get into college, she&#8217;s love at first sight.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><a href="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/MI-01-01-06.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-767" title="MI-01-01-06" src="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/MI-01-01-06.jpg" alt="" width="361" height="558" /></a></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">The story takes off from there in a sort of twisted snake&#8217;s nest of misunderstanding. The main plotline is the romance between Kyoko and Godai, but it&#8217;s not an easy romance. The other tenants, other love interest, and the two main characters themselves complicate things so much that you really don&#8217;t know if this is going to be a happy story or one that ends bittersweetly. There are times when the series is both, and Takahashi does a wonderful job of not letting you relax. Ever.</p>
<p style="text-align: left;">I read this series straight through. There were some nights when I&#8217;d start reading at before bed, expecting only to read a few chapters, and then suddenly it was 7am and I still couldn&#8217;t bring myself to stop. Takahashi is a master at getting the reader to turn the pages because you HAVE to know what happens next. Will Godai confess to Kyoko? Will Kyoko keep acting clueless or will she face the situation? Will the other tenants ever stop partying? Will <em>anyone</em> ever be decisive about serious situations?</p>
<p style="text-align: left;"><a href="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/mi1.jpg"><img class="size-full wp-image-758 aligncenter" title="mi1" src="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/mi1.jpg" alt="" width="392" height="147" /></a></p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><a href="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/mi1.jpg"></a><a href="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/mi6.jpg"><img class="size-full wp-image-763 aligncenter" title="mi6" src="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/mi6.jpg" alt="" width="403" height="224" /></a></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Even when you get a little fed up with this series, you can&#8217;t stop. I&#8217;ll admit, halfway through, I was just getting tired of all the misunderstanding. Over and over again Godai and Kyoko get <em>this</em> close to making progress in their relationship, and then something stupid happens and ruins it. It&#8217;s tormenting, and you both love it and hate it.</p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Also, something that kind of caused me to pause while reading was the similarities in appearances between some of the characters. This wasn&#8217;t a problem when the similar looking characters were not in the same scene, but when they got together, I often had to stop and check to see what each character was wearing in order to keep them straight. Below is an image of Kyoko&#8217;s and Godai&#8217;s rivals talking together &#8211; if it weren&#8217;t for Kozue saying Mitaka&#8217;s name, just looking at this wouldn&#8217;t tell the reader whether or not that were Godai or Mitaka sitting with her. You can look at the image of Godai and Kyoko two panels up for comparison. They <em>do </em>look different when you&#8217;re paying attention, but when you&#8217;re breezing through the story, they look too similar and this becomes a problem in some parts.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><a href="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/mi8.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-765" title="mi8" src="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/mi8.jpg" alt="" width="408" height="121" /></a></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Still, this minor nuisance isn&#8217;t enough to really ruin the reading experience, and it&#8217;s easy to overlook it. Takahashi&#8217;s overall art style is so quaint and attractive, that you end up not minding having to slow down and look at the images a little more closely.</p>
<p style="text-align: left;">And despite the constant obstacles the characters all face, you care about them too much to give up on them. I think if I had read the series slowly over time, and had a bit of a gap between each volume, I wouldn&#8217;t have gotten frustrated at the slower progress of the relationships. In a way, I wish that&#8217;s how I read it. In retrospect, I&#8217;m glad it was a slow build up to a really great climax &#8211; it was a very good representation of real life relationships and how they take time and nurturing to develop and mature, which is probably also the best part of this series. The slowness, while frustrating, is accurate and allows for more character development and reader investment. I think the trend in young adult fiction nowadays is to have the romance barrel the reader over halfway through the first chapter, and while there is a sweet budding romance immediately in this story, it doesn&#8217;t rush.</p>
<p style="text-align: left;">The story is often laugh-out-loud funny and even the characters ask themselves how they get into such insane situations. The side characters are just as lovable as the main characters, and even though you constantly wonder why the main characters put up with some of their associates, by the end of the series, you understand perfectly and wouldn&#8217;t want it any other way.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><a href="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/mi9.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-789" title="mi9" src="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/mi9.jpg" alt="" width="285" height="320" /></a></p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><a href="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/mi9.jpg"></a><a href="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/mi3.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-760" title="mi3" src="http://www.devilandthesea.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/04/mi3.jpg" alt="" width="298" height="238" /></a></p>
<p style="text-align: center;">
<p style="text-align: left;">All in all, this was a wonderful early series by Rumiko Takahashi, and despite it&#8217;s minor complaints, it really deserves a read by anyone who is a manga fan and doubly so for any romantic. This one is going on my To-Buy List.</p>
